Description Are you ready to move your career forward? As a Logistics Trainee, you will be part of a winning team that inspires the next chapter of growth. Penske’s Logistics Trainee Program is our management trainee experience built specifically for individuals interested in supply chain careers, logistics operations, and leadership development. This structured program provides hands-on training across multiple logistics functions and prepares you for future leadership roles within Penske Logistics. Our Program: This position is best suited for candidates who want to gain valuable experience to launch their career with Penske. Our dedicated training program will prepare you to oversee logistics operations including customer service, freight loading and unloading, dispatch and proper documentation and procedure control. Hands-on experience will help you learn to effectively manage driver deliveries, loading/unloading of trailers, cross docking and customer service operations in a manner consistent with company services and cost objectives. Upon graduation from the program, you’ll be prepared to lead a small group of hourly associates in a dedicated contract carriage operation. •Ensure that all associates are motivated, engaged, trained and competent and understand how their work relates to the customers' business objectives. •Foster a safe work environment by complying with and administering established safety and operational procedures. •Understand the location-specific customer goals & objectives and work to meet and exceed these expectations daily. •Effectively resolve issues and monitor day-to-day operations for compliance using organizational and time management skills. •Learn the Kaizen methodology and implement Lean processes. •Evaluate and recommend changes in preferred work methods to increase productivity of dispatch operations. •Properly plan work assignments to ensure effective use of fleet/ equipment. Company About Penske Logistics Penske Logistics engineers state-of-the-art transportation, warehousing and supply chain management solutions that deliver powerful business results for market-leading companies. With operations in North America, South America, Europe and Asia, Penske and its associates help businesses move forward by increasing visibility and driving down supply-chain costs.
